Gil-
A book worth checking out is Paul Frère's "Porsche racing cars of the seventies"; amongst many other things it charts the development of the 935s, inc. 'Moby Dick' and explains most of the various modifications, wings and fenders, door cowlings and other little tweaks that were tried out, (plus a mass of comparative aerodynamic data, in case you have trouble sleeping! )
